Busia Produce Dealers Multi- Purpose Cooperatives Society v Stanbic Bank (U) Limited
Busia Produce Dealers Multi- Purpose Cooperatives Society v Stanbic Bank (U) Limited (Civil Miscellaneous Application No. 185 of 2021) [2021] UGCA 107 (12 October 2021)
The application for an interim injunction was dismissed because there was no valid appeal on record at the time of hearing. The applicant conceded that the appeal was filed out of time and relied on a pending application for extension of time or validation of the appeal. The Court held that the existence of a competent notice of appeal alone was insufficient where the statutory period for filing the appeal had expired.
